Let's start with wages. Minimum wage is the floor, not the target. Know your local minimum wage - it might be higher than federal. Pay attention to overtime rules. If someone works over 40 hours, they need that time-and-a-half. No exceptions.
Scheduling deserves careful attention. Some states require predictive scheduling - giving workers their schedules well in advance. Keep accurate records of all hours worked. If someone picks up an extra shift, document it.
Here's something crucial - discrimination and harassment policies. These need to be clear, written down, and followed every time. Everyone deserves a workplace free from harassment and discrimination. Train your team on what's not acceptable and what to do if they see problems.
Young workers need extra protection. Know the rules about hiring minors - what hours they can work, what tasks they can do. These rules are strict for good reason. Don't risk breaking them.
Question: Why is it important to document every change in an employee's schedule, even if it seems minor?
Think about it. The answer? Accurate records protect both the store and the employee if questions arise about hours worked or overtime pay. Plus, many states require detailed scheduling records.
